Book excerpt: Self-lubricating composites were prepared by vacuum-impregnating porous nickel or Inconel X-750 (nickel-chromium alloy) with a barium fluoride - calcium fluoride eutectic composition. Density measurements and photomicrographs of the resulting composite structures demonstrated that this process completely filled the voids of the porous metals with the fluoride eutectic. The compressive yield strength of the nickel composites was quite low (about 30 000 psi); therefore, in order to avoid severe plastic deformation during the friction and wear experiments, it was necessary to employ moderate contact stresses. However, alloy composites were comparatively resistant to plastic deformation; the compressive yield strength was 78 000 pounds per square inch or about 75 percent of the strength of the age-hardened alloy in the dense, wrought form. The air at moderate contact stresses, the friction and wear properties of nickel composites were only slightly inferior to those of the alloy composites. Oxidation of nickel composites becomes serious at 12000 F, however, and limits the usefulness of this material in air to a maximum temperature of about 11000 F. The corresponding temperature limitation of the alloy composites in air was about 1350 F. In a hydrogen atmosphere, the alloy composites performed satisfactorily to 15000 F and may be suitable to somewhat higher temperatures. The frictional properties of the composites were significantly improved by the application of a thin, sintered coating of the eutectic fluoride to the bearing surfaces of the composites.

Book excerpt: The Amicon nonmetallic coating system previously developed for use on chromium-rich alloys was investigated for use on TD-Nickel in the 2200 to 2400 F. range. Major advances were made during the program. A simple air oxidation pretreatment of the base alloy resulted in excellent coating adhesion without special chromium precoating. A new family of coatings from talc, BaCrO4 and B2O3 were developed which gave major performance advantages over previous coatings. Further additions of forsterite increased coating oxidation resistance still further. The program resulted in a new coating for TD-Nickel which can be spray applied and fired in air to give a thin, tough and abrasion resistant coating providing at least an order-of-magnitude reduction in oxidation at temperatures up to 2300 F. Book excerpt: The purpose of this study was to develop and upgrade aluminum containing coating systems for the protection of nickel and cobalt alloys used in gas turbine hot section components. A comprehensive investigation of modifying elements was undertaken and correlated with hot corrosion resistance and diffusional stability under blade and vane cycle conditions (1950 amd 2200F peak temperatures, respectively). The modifying elements and combinations evaluated were Co, Mn, Cr, Ta, Fe, Mg, Si, Y, Cr-Mn, Co-Cr and Fe-Cr. The influence of the modified coatings on mechanical properties, stress-oxidation, impact and thermal shock of the superalloys was also determined. (Author).
